Social stories are an essential tool for individuals who need help with certain behaviors or situations. These stories provide a visual and simple way to explain appropriate behavior and expectations. In this post, we will explore a variety of social stories and how they can be used effectively.

Social Story: I Need Help

I Need Help Social StoryThe first social story we will discuss is titled “I Need Help.” This story focuses on teaching individuals to ask for assistance when needed. It emphasizes the importance of recognizing the need for help and seeking support from trusted adults or peers.

Free, printable “folder stories.”

Folder Stories“Folder stories” are simple, one-page social stories that can be easily printed and folded into a compact booklet. They are ideal for individuals who need frequent reminders of appropriate behavior. These stories cover various topics such as following rules, sharing, and using kind words. They can be carried in a pocket or backpack for quick access and reinforcement.

Social stories are a valuable tool for teaching appropriate behavior, addressing challenging situations, and promoting social skills development. By using engaging visuals, simple language, and personalized content, these stories effectively support individuals in understanding and practicing positive behaviors. Whether you are a parent, teacher, or caregiver, incorporating social stories into daily routines can make a significant difference in the lives of individuals who need extra guidance and support.
